European steel industry calls for reduction of flat steel import quota

It was reported that Eurometal announced that flat steel product shipments fell by 18.5% during January to April compared with the same period of 2019.

European steel producers urged EU to reduce import quotas because a large number of steel imports had threatened the steel industry which has been ravaged by COVID-19 epidemic. The statement pointed out that steel companies against to recent adjustment of protection measures of EU which began in 2018.

Statement signed include important global steel producer such as ArcelorMittal, TataSteel, ThyssenKrupp and Salzgitter.
